inMotion Announces the First Self-Contained, IR-Assisted Camera to Incorporate Pixim Nightwolf Imaging Solution and Motorized, Remote Lens Control

 

Based on Pixim Nightwolf, inMotion’s new IR-assisted camera series eliminates IR hot spots under nighttime conditions while still providing high-quality daytime color images.

 

MOUNTAIN VIEW, Calif. – May 08, 2012 - Pixim Inc., a leading provider of imaging technology for enterprise security cameras, announced today that inMotion Ltd is introducing a new, Pixim Nightwolf-powered camera series. The inMotion in71 bullet and in21 box CCTV cameras, based on Nightwolf eliminate hot spots common to IR cameras. Using innovative digital imaging technology, inMotion’s Nightwolf-powered cameras are able to capture both foreground and background details even in cases where very strong IR lighting is deployed.

inMotion & Kiwi Semiconductor release.

inMotion to place its support behind iCCTV™
High-end cctv equipment manufacturer inMotion Inc. announces its new line-up of new iCCTV™ enabled cameras and DVR’s.  iCCTV™ is quickly becoming a de-facto standard for Closed Circuit Television systems (CCTV) consisting of technology developed by New Zealand Kiwi Semiconductor Ltd.  The technology enables DVR’s such as those offered by inMotion to remotely control camera/lens parameters such as motorized focus/zoom and on-screen display (OSD) using only coax cabling, without the requirement for RS-485 wiring.
